Tailoring Fully Biobased Optical Adhesives via Hydrogen-Bonding Modulation

BNBenjamin R. NelsonVSVincent ScholiersASAudrey H Sakamoto

Key Points

  • The aim is to develop optical adhesives with enhanced properties using biobased materials.
  • Developed optical adhesives using hydrogen-bonding modulation.
  • Evaluated optical clarity, refractive index, and adhesive strength of new formulations.
  • Achieved high optical clarity with minimal birefringence in new adhesive formulations.
  • Demonstrated improved adhesive strength when compared to conventional petroleum-derived systems.

Abstract

Display technologies require optical adhesives that simultaneously provide high optical clarity, refractive index control, low birefringence and adhesive strength. However, many commercial adhesive systems rely on petroleum-derived acrylates and isocyanate-based...
